PremièrePLUS+ is a unique graduate development programme which will fast track your career in one of Northern Ireland’s fastest growing sectors; the Agri-Food industry. This sector offers the potential for high earnings in a challenging, dynamic working environment.
More food for thought...
The PremièrePLUS+ programme provides you with:
- Structured training with Parity leading to a Chartered Management Institute diploma at level 5 and a food related qualification from The College of Agriculture, Food and Rural Enterprise at Loughry.
- A challenging 17 week Business Improvement Project.
- A dedicated career coaching service.

PremièrePLUS+ was developed in response to a key recommendation of the Fit for Market Strategy being implemented by DARD and Invest NI under the guidance of the Food Strategy Implementation Partnership.
The PremièrePLUS+ programme gives you the opportunity to:
- Recruit a trained and talented graduate into your company who has a fresh perspective, initiative, drive and enthusiasm.
- Drive forward an area of your business in sales/marketing, finance, promotion, quality, human resources, technology or ICT through the graduate’s completion of a 17 week Business Improvement Project. The outputs of previous PremièrePLUS+ projects have averaged at £15,000.
- Receive support from an experienced Parity consultant.
Over the years Parity’s consultancy team have developed close working relationships within the Agri-Food sector - we know the key issues and challenges you face and understand your business needs. This allows us to match the most suitable graduate to your Project.
